thankful

November 26, 2009 By Kristin Zecchinelli

Today, on this day of giving thanks here in the states,  I wish to further honor November’s one word,  gratitude, we have been so beautifully celebrating here at Shutter Sisters.  Gratitude can mean so many different things at different times.  There are the big things to be grateful for such as love, family, home, health, and peace.  Yet many times it is the little things that can mean so much.  The beauty found in the details of a day; the way a wisp of hair falls just so,  or the way a certain slant of light brings warmth and happiness to a room.  Welcoming a new day with your favorite cup of coffee, or the comfort only a favorite loved toy can bring to a child.   Simple, everyday blessings.  In the hustle of our busy lives it is easy lose sight of what is right in front of us.  Photography has given us a way to honor these little things and quiet moments that add up a beautiful whole.  The simple process of taking a photo not only allows us to see what is in front of us, but to feel it.  This quote by Karen Krakoer Kaplan says it so perfectly, “Gratitude is noticing the extraordinary in the ordinary. And then taking the nanosecond to feel it.”

So today, lets give thanks together.  Slow down for just for a moment, capture a little~big thing are you grateful for, and share it with us all here.  Give the gift of this moment to yourself and really feel it.
